The Northumberland County Historical Society (NCHS) recently launched Episode 6 in the Countdown to Independence series, “Northern Neck Churches and the American Revolution,” by Mark Huffman.
The Revolutionary War had a major impact on life in Northumberland County and the Northern Neck, affecting politics and commerce. It also affected the religious aspect of society in various ways, reshaping the roles of the region’s churches, their social influence and their legal standing, reported NCHS publications chairman Richard Covington.
